What is a Lean-To Conservatory?

A lean-to conservatory, also known as a "mono-pitch" conservatory, is defined by its single-pitched roofing system that slopes below a wall. This style provides itself well to smaller gardens or homes with minimal outside space. The lean-to structure is not only elegant but likewise extremely functional, offering a smooth shift in between indoor and outside living.


Benefits of Lean-To Conservatories

BenefitDescription
Space EfficiencyLean-to conservatories make use of space successfully, making them ideal for small gardens or properties.
CostNormally more cost-effective than bigger or more sophisticated conservatories while still providing adequate space.
AdaptabilityThey can be used for numerous functions, consisting of dining areas, playrooms, or a comfortable reading nook.
Natural LightThe glass roofing system and walls permit an abundance of natural light, making the area brilliant and welcoming.
Energy EfficiencyModern materials and heating solutions can boost energy performance, making lean-to conservatories functional year-round.
Quick InstallationLean-to styles often require less time for setup compared to more complex structures.

Style Options for Lean-To Conservatories

When thinking about a lean-to conservatory, there are various style choices to choose from that can match both conventional and modern homes. Below is a list of popular style options:

Materials:

  • uPVC: Low upkeep, resilient, and available in various colors.
  • Aluminium: Sleek, contemporary look with exceptional thermal homes.
  • Wood: Offers a timeless aesthetic but requires regular upkeep.

Roofing Options:

  • Glass Roof: Maximizes natural light and supplies a sense of openness.
  • Polycarbonate: Provides insulation and is lightweight, perfect for economical jobs.
  • Strong Roof: Balances light and insulation, providing a comfy year-round environment.

Style:

  • Traditional: Features ornate details and classic styles to match duration homes.
  • Modern: Minimalist style with clean lines and big glass panels.
  • Victorian or Edwardian: Elaborate structures with elaborate styles, appropriate for more considerable homes.

Frequently Asked Questions About Lean-To Conservatories

1. How much does a lean-to conservatory typically cost?Costs can vary drastically based on size, materials, and design. Usually, prices can vary from ₤ 5,000 to ₤ 25,000.

2. Do  Windows And Doors R Us  need preparing consent for a lean-to conservatory?In many cases, lean-to conservatories fall under permitted development rights. Nevertheless, it's important to inspect local guidelines, especially for larger structures.

3. Can I utilize my lean-to conservatory all year round?Yes, with appropriate insulation and heating, a lean-to conservatory can be taken pleasure in year-round.

4. How long does it require to develop a lean-to conservatory?The setup process normally takes anywhere from a few days to numerous weeks, depending upon the complexity of the style and the climate condition.

5. What maintenance is needed for lean-to conservatories?Routine upkeep includes cleansing rain gutters, looking for leaks, and examining seals. The materials you choose might need various levels of care.
